Ideal Planting Locations

🌞 Sunlight Exposure Requirements

Full Sun vs. Partial Shade

For your Goshiki False Holly to thrive, it needs 6-8 hours of direct sunlight each day. While it can tolerate partial shade, be aware that this may lead to a loss of its vibrant variegation.

Seasonal Sunlight Variations

It's crucial to assess how sunlight exposure changes throughout the year. Surrounding trees or structures can significantly impact light availability, so consider their positions when choosing a planting spot.

🌱 Soil Type Preferences

Ideal Soil Conditions

Goshiki False Holly prefers well-drained, acidic to neutral soil with a pH of 6.0-7.0. The texture matters too; sandy loam or loamy soil is ideal for optimal growth.

Soil Amendments for Optimal Growth

To enhance soil quality, add organic matter like compost or peat moss. Regularly testing your soil with pH kits and nutrient analysis can help ensure it meets the plant's needs.

πŸ“ Assessing the Best Spot

Evaluating Sunlight and Shade Patterns

Use simple techniques to assess light conditions in your garden. Identify areas that receive consistent shade, as these spots may not be suitable for your Goshiki False Holly.

Analyzing Soil Drainage and Quality

Good drainage is vital for this plant's health. If your soil isn't draining well, consider ways to improve its quality, such as incorporating organic matter.

🌬️ Environmental Considerations

Wind Protection Strategies

Wind can be detrimental to Goshiki False Holly, so consider effective windbreak options. This could include planting shrubs or installing fences to shield your plant from harsh winds.

Seasonal Changes and Their Impact on Planting Location

Be mindful of how seasonal light and temperature variations affect your planting location. Preparing for winter conditions is essential to ensure your Goshiki False Holly remains healthy year-round.

🏑 Indoor vs. Outdoor Planting

Best Indoor Locations for Goshiki False Holly

If you choose to plant indoors, look for spots that provide bright, indirect light. Container considerations are also important; ensure your pot has good drainage.

Outdoor Planting Considerations

For outdoor planting, select locations that offer ample sunlight and protection from harsh elements. Keep seasonal planting tips in mind to give your Goshiki False Holly the best start possible.
